A two-step strategy for SAR studies of N- methylated Aβ42 C-terminal fragments as Aβ42 toxicity inhibitors

Neurotoxic Aβ42 oligomers are believed to be the main cause of Alzheimer’s disease. Previously, we found that the C-terminal fragments (CTFs), Aβ(30–42) and Aβ(31–42) were the most potent inhibitors of Aβ42 oligomerization and toxicity in a series of Aβ(x–42) peptides, (x=28–39).
